Grahan 'Upper Terraces' Selection 2022
ZOM-IND-HIM-0920220114
At a Glance
Classification Landrace
Accession Type Selection
Selection Type Multiple plants
Sex Female
Primary Purpose Multipurpose
Flowering Time 16–20 weeks
Plant Height 1.5–3.0 m
Photoperiod Short-day
Terpenes Unknown
Botanical Characteristics
Growth Pattern Christmas tree, Columnar
Branching Apical dominant
Leaf Shape Intermediate
Leaf Color Dark greens, Purples
Processing
Method Charas
Hierarchy
Growing Region Western Himalayas
Growing Area Parvati Valley
Appellation Grahan Valley
Field Grahan Upper Terraces
Location
Country India
Province/State Himachal Pradesh
Kullu District
Bhuntar Tehsil
Bhuntar Block
Locality Grahan
Coordinates 31.97337415, 77.349218
Elevation 2,425 m
Aspect SW
Traditional Names
Local Name गाँजा
Pronunciation Gāñjā
Collection
Method Seeds
Sourcing Type Point of Origin
Autochthonous Yes
Date 10/09/2023
Harvest Date 2022
Collector Éloïse
Expedition HIMA01
Conservation
Priority Medium
Legal Threats Active eradication campaigns
Population Est. 1,000,000
M/F Ratio 10%%
Culling Some
Introgression Minimal
Cultivation
Status Active
System Type Rotating, Monoculture
Scale Widespread regional cultivation
Seed Sourcing Seeds are grown on the farm
Planting Method Broadcasting
Preservation
Seed Storage Zomia Genetic Library

Grahan Valley 'Upper Terraces' Selection 2022 is a landrace cannabis accession documented by the Zomia Collective in India.

Geography

Grahan is located in the Parvati Valley growing area of the Western Himalayas growing region in India.
